The nominees for April 15-20 are:

Weightlifting

Kale Bunce, Palmetto: At the Class 3A Boys USA Weightlifting Florida High School State Championships, Bunce took first in the 169-pound division with a combined lift of 575 pounds in the Olympic discipline (snatch and clean and jerk).

Track & field

Christopher Priede, Venice: At the Sarasota County Track and Field Championships, Priede took first in both the 110-meter hurdles (15.65) and 400-meter hurdles (55.20), the latter a PR.

Flag football

Cydnee Brooks, Braden River: In her team's 41-0 victory over Estero in a Class 1A regional quarterfinal game, Brooks, playing quarterback, accounted for all of her team's points. She finished 14-of-17 for 205 yards, throwing four touchdowns, rushing for a TD, and returning an interception 30 yards for a score. She also had another pick in the game.

Softball

Desiree Aiken, Palmetto: In her team's 5-0 victory over 15-3 Riverview, Aiken hurled a complete-game one-hitter, allowing one hit with 10 strikeouts. At the plate, she finished 3-4 with a home run, double, run scored and two RBI.

Baseball

Nate Winterhalter, Venice: In Venice's 7-2 victory over Parrish, Winterhalter came on in relief of starter Jackson Lucas and pitched three innings, not allowing a run and striking out six.

Boys lacrosse

Mickey Cohen, Lakewood Ranch: In his team's 16-15 victory over Manatee in the Class 2A-11 district final, Cohen scored the tying goal with 0.1 seconds left in regulation, then scored the game-winner with 53.7 seconds left in the first sudden-death overtime. Cohen finished the game with three goals.

Girls lacrosse

Haley Rosa, Saint Stephen's: In her team's 16-4 victory over St. Petersburg Catholic in the Class 1A-10 district final, Rosa finished with seven goals and three assists.
